What software programs can open SVG files?

Many graphic design and vector graphics software programs, including Adobe Illustrator, Inkscape, and CorelDRAW, can open and edit SVG files.

What is an SVG file used for in crafting?

SVG (Scalable Vector Graphics) files are commonly used to create digital cutting designs for Cricut machines, Brother ScanNCut, and other craft cutters.
